Automated spam (advertising) or intrustion attempts (hacking).You may want to visit the Mission chat channels in the game to learn more.Your current IP address has been blocked due to bad behavior, which generally means one of the following: Faction spawns are also available on the level 4 missions, such as The Blockade and Worlds Collide. These seldom spawns result in much higher bounties and can as well drop valuable equipment. There are some missions, which can spawn a pirate group ship as one of the target objects. Thus, it’s very important to watch your back in such territories. Mission runners must expect being ambushed by pirate groups in low security areas. The upper quality agents are all found outside of Empire space.Īlthough mission running rewards in systems with lower security are higher, the risks are higher as well. You’ll get higher mission revenues and higher amounts of LP’s in systems with lower security levels. The security level of the system, where you are on a mission essentially affects your rewards. Of course, if you’re just purchasing things for your personal collection, you can apply your own measures. The broad range of possibilities and offers combined with the dynamic market of EVE make getting maximum profit offers sort of a black magic, but you should generally aim to get about 1,000 ISKs for each spent LP. Be cautious, because your ship can get destroyed, if you carry these tags in the space of the faction you got them from, as it’s illegal. They can normally be collected during missions from ship wreckages from hostile Empires. Dogtags are a general demand for lots of offers of the Empires. Normally, the requested built items are the Tech I version of what you’re trying to get. Every offer can demand a certain combination of LPs, ISK, dogtags, and built items. Once you get access to the store, you’re able to see the entire spectrum of offers obtainable from that corporation. You can access the Store by clicking the proper service button, when at a station that belongs to the corporation. Thus, mission running for agents from one corporation will increase your LP’s amount. Loyalty Points are associated with specific NPC corporations. Once you start running missions for a certain NPC corporation, you will begin to receive Loyalty Points and get access to the store of the corporation. LP, or Loyalty Points, can be one of the most significant rewards in agent missions.
